For 23 years, the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\">Good Neighbor Awards<\/a> has recognized real estate professionals who make an extraordinary impact on their communities through volunteer work. The five individuals named as this year\u2019s winners exemplify how REALTORS\u00ae make their communities a better place to live, work and raise a family.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cI am so proud to honor our Good Neighbor Awards winners for how they\u2019ve effected change to improve the lives of others in their communities,\u201d says NAR President Leslie Rouda Smith. \u201cEach of these REALTORS\u00ae has devoted hundreds of hours a year and raised huge sums of money for their respective causes. I salute them for their vision, dedication, passion and selfless generosity.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Each of the five winners, who were selected by a multi-stage, criteria-based judging process, will receive a $10,000 grant for their charity and be featured in the fall 2022 issue of <a href=\"https:\/\/magazine.realtor\/\">REALTOR\u00ae Magazine<\/a>. That experience opened her eyes to an underlying vulnerability in her affluent, Atlanta-area neighborhood that extended well beyond food. She founded the nonprofit, <a href=\"https:\/\/solidaritysandysprings.org\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Solidarity Sandy Springs<\/a>, which inspires more than 2,600 volunteers to provide wide-ranging community services for thousands of families, including free eye exams and glasses, flu vaccines, job fairs, back-to-school backpacks and more. Barnes has also distributed nearly one million pounds of food to approximately 46,000 shoppers. <a href=\"http: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/from-hunger-to-happiness\">Read her story<\/a> and <a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/gna-winner-2022-jennifer-barnes\">watch the video<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/adding-hope-to-the-grocery-list\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/magazine.realtor\/sites\/default\/files\/styles\/asset_image_full_content\/public\/assets\/images\/GNA_Curtin_0.jpg?itok=J9dvT3mv\" alt=\"Dennis Curtin\"\/><\/a><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/adding-hope-to-the-grocery-list\"><strong>Dennis Curtin<\/strong><\/a><br \/>Legacy Investments<br \/>Kansas City, Mo.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Dennis Curtin founded <a href=\"https:\/\/www.mimispantrykc.org\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Mimi\u2019s Pantry<\/a> to offer a more positive food pantry experience to people in need. The state-of-the-art, 6,000-square-foot facility welcomes shoppers to browse the aisles and choose their food, just as they would in a grocery store. The nonprofit invested in commercial refrigeration equipment and offers fresh meat, produce and milk. It also has a play area and library for kids and is currently building a greenhouse and an orchard of fruit trees and berry bushes. In three years, it has served 50,000 individuals. <a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/adding-hope-to-the-grocery-list\">Read his story<\/a> and <a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/gna-winner-2022-dennis-curtin\">watch the video<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/not-enough-homes-in-paradise\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/magazine.realtor\/sites\/default\/files\/styles\/asset_image_full_content\/public\/assets\/images\/GNA_Edmonds_0.jpg?itok=Z06nqCMH\" alt=\"2022 Good Neighbor Award winner Jim Edmonds\"\/><\/a><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/not-enough-homes-in-paradise\"><strong>Jim Edmonds<\/strong><\/a><br \/>Emerald Isle Properties<br \/>Kilauea, Hawaii<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Since the Hawaiian island of Kaua\u2019i may only have a handful of homes for sale under $1 million at any time, Jim Edmonds, founder of the nonprofit <a href=\"https:\/\/www.pal-kauai.org\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Permanently Affordable Living (PAL) Kaua&#8217;i<\/a>, partners with other nonprofits to build and convert affordable housing for workers. Edmonds navigates the complex challenges of poor infrastructure and resource scarcity through innovative, cost-saving solutions like solar energy, edible landscaping, shared electric vehicles and shared bicycles. <a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/not-enough-homes-in-paradise\">Read his story<\/a> and <a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/gna-winner-2022-jim-edmonds\">watch the video<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/filling-a-need-near-or-far\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/magazine.realtor\/sites\/default\/files\/styles\/asset_image_full_content\/public\/assets\/images\/GNA_Lapierre_0.jpg?itok=nvXLa50j\" alt=\"Heather Griesser LaPierre\"\/><\/a><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/filling-a-need-near-or-far\"><strong>Heather Griesser LaPierre<\/strong><\/a><br \/>RE\/MAX Preferred Newtown Square<br \/>Newtown Square, Pa.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>To address food insecurity in her neighborhood and worldwide, Heather Griesser LaPierre founded <a href=\"https:\/\/www.facebook.com\/kidsagainsthungerphilly\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Kids Against Hunger Philadelphia<\/a>. She rallies hundreds of volunteers each month to pack nutritious, ready-to-make pasta- and rice-based meals. When schools were shut down in 2021, she doubled production to 350,000 meals per month to ensure children who depended on school lunches were fed. Since 2015, she has packed and distributed more than 9 million meals. <a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/filling-a-need-near-or-far\">Read her story<\/a> and <a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/gna-winner-2022-heather-griesser-lapierre\">watch the video<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/turning-teens-into-champions\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/magazine.realtor\/sites\/default\/files\/styles\/asset_image_full_content\/public\/assets\/images\/GNA_Washington_0.jpg?itok=NKdDujpg\" alt=\"2022 Good Neighbor Award winner MaliVai Washington\"\/><\/a><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/turning-teens-into-champions\"><strong>MaliVai Washington<\/strong><\/a><br \/>Diamond Life Real Estate<br \/>Jacksonville Beach, Fla.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>For 26 years,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.malwashington.com\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">MaliVai Washington Youth Foundation<\/a> (MWYF) founder Mal Washington has been breaking the cycle of poverty through a vibrant after-school mentoring program. Originally rooted in his beloved sport of tennis, MWYF now serves 500 kids annually through a comprehensive youth development program of academic tutoring, leadership skills, financial training and fitness. He is proud of the 100% high school graduation rate of the program as the surrounding neighborhood\u2019s dropout rate is 20%. <a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/turning-teens-into-champions\">Read his story<\/a> and <a href=\"https:\/\/www.nar.realtor\/good-neighbor-awards\/gna-winner-2022-malivai-washington\">watch the video<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>In addition to the winners, the following five REALTORS\u00ae have been recognized as Good Neighbor Award honorable mentions and will each receive $2,500 grants for their charity: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\"><li><a href=\"https:\/\/nar.realtor\/gna\/tami-hicks\">Tamara &#8220;Tami&#8221; Hicks<\/a> of Century 21 Signature Real Estate in Ames, Iowa, whose nonprofit <a href=\"https:\/\/www.overflowthriftstore.org\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Overflow Thrift Store<\/a> has raised more than a half-million dollars for charities and has saved millions of items from landfills.<\/li><li><a href=\"https:\/\/nar.realtor\/gna\/lisa-hoeve\">Lisa Hoeve<\/a> of Coldwell Banker Woodland Schmidt in Holland, Mich., whose nonprofit <a href=\"https:\/\/www.hopepkgs.org\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Hope Pkgs<\/a> has provided overnight comfort bags to more than 4,200 foster children.<\/li><li><a href=\"https:\/\/nar.realtor\/gna\/debbie-mccabe\">Debbie McCabe<\/a> of Berkshire Hathaway HomeServices Fox &amp; Roach, REALTORS\u00ae, and the Trident Group in Devon, Pa., whose nonprofit <a href=\"https:\/\/www.covenanthousepa.org\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Covenant House Pennsylvania<\/a> houses and empowers young people facing homelessness.<\/li><li><a href=\"https:\/\/nar.realtor\/gna\/debbie-miller\">Debbie Miller<\/a> of Webpro Realty in Lakeland, Fla., whose nonprofit <a href=\"https:\/\/www.kidspack.org\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">kidsPACK<\/a> feeds 3,000 children on weekends when they don\u2019t get school lunch.<\/li><li><a href=\"https:\/\/nar.realtor\/gna\/kathy-opperman\">Kathy Opperman<\/a> of Long &amp; Foster Real Estate in Collegeville, Pa., whose nonprofit <a href=\"https:\/\/pillarsoflightandlove.org\/home\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Pillars of Light and Love<\/a> has offered 800 free workshops and support groups to build self-esteem and resilience in adults and kids.<\/li><\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>In September, realtor.com\u00ae, a primary sponsor of the Good Neighbor Awards, invited the public to vote for their favorite of the 10 finalists.
